It's been nearly 20 year since Alicia Silverstone played spoiled high school student Cher Horowitz in the 1995 cult classic Clueless. The film launched the actress into stardom, just as it did for costars Stacey Dash, 46, Paul Rudd, 43, Donald Faison, 38, and the late Brittany Murphy, who passed away at age 32 in December 2009.
Dash recently starred in VH1's Single Ladies, while bonafide a-lister Rudd's film credits include The 40-Year-Old Virgin, Knocked Up and I Love You, Man. Faison — currently engaged to Jessica Simpson's BFF Cacee Cobb — has worked steadily in TV. Silverstone, meanwhile, has been busy taking care of son Bear Blu, 16 months, with husband Christopher Jarecki. She recently teamed up with Clueless director/writer Amy Heckerling for the movie Vamps, in theaters November 2.
The former cast members have, at times, reunited over the years on TV and in movies. Most recently, in the spring of 2012, Silverstone — who turned 36 October 4 — played Jeremy Sisto's girlfriend in ABC's Suburgatory.
"We were good friends back in the day so it's been really nice to personally reconnect and meet her baby and to hear stories about her life over the last 10 years," Sisto, 37, told The Huffington Post. "I think it's a great moment to see these two actors back together."
